Jon Le Vert's Releases Latest Album 'wish u well': A Nomadic Journey Through Sound and Self

Jon Le Vert’s wish u well offers a sonic diary, a deeply personal reflection of two years lived on the road, dedicated entirely to artistic exploration. The Chicago native’s latest project is a testament to his evolution, showcasing a unique blend of hip-hop, emo alt-rock, and electronic music, all self-written and self-produced.wish u well feels like a significant step forward for Le Vert, a true debut in his eyes. While his previous project, DARK AGES, served as a training ground, wish u well is where he truly comes into his own. The album is a testament to his dedication to originality, a quest to create something fresh and personally fulfilling.

The album’s nomadic genesis is palpable. There’s a sense of freedom and exploration woven into the tracks, reflecting the artist’s own journey. Le Vert’s willingness to experiment with genres and push boundaries results in a sound that’s both diverse and cohesive.

“renaissance,” the standout single, perfectly encapsulates Le Vert’s artistic vision. The track seamlessly merges intricate production with raw, emotional storytelling, demonstrating his ability to craft music that’s both technically impressive and deeply resonant. The lyrics are introspective and honest, offering a glimpse into Le Vert’s inner world.

wish u well is a testament to the power of self-production. Le Vert’s control over every aspect of the album allows for a truly authentic and personal expression. He’s not afraid to take risks, blending genres and experimenting with sounds to create a unique sonic experience.

Le Vert’s goal is to leave a lasting impact, to offer listeners something original and varied. With wish u well, he achieves just that. This is an album that demands to be listened to closely, rewarding listeners with its depth, complexity, and emotional honesty. Jon Le Vert has created a project that feels both personal and universal, a sonic journey that invites listeners to embark on their own introspective exploration.
